When is the best time to visit Brussels
Brussels has an oceanic climate. In summer (Jun–Aug) the average high is around 22°C, while in winter (Dec–Feb) it sits near 6°C by day and 1°C at night. The hottest month is July (23°C) and the coldest is January (1°C).
The best time to visit is May, June, July, August, September, when conditions are most comfortable for sightseeing and walking around. November, December, January, February can be less comfortable — keep that in mind when planning.
Brussels temperatures & rainfall by month
Long-term monthly averages (climate normals).
| Month | High | Low | Daily range | Rain |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 6° | 1° | 76 mm | |
| Feb | 7° | 1° | 63 mm | |
| Mar | 11° | 3° | 70 mm | |
| Apr | 14° | 5° | 51 mm | |
| May | 18° | 9° | 67 mm | |
| Jun● | 21° | 12° | 72 mm | |
| Jul | 23° | 14° | 74 mm | |
| Aug | 23° | 14° | 76 mm | |
| Sep | 19° | 11° | 69 mm | |
| Oct | 15° | 8° | 75 mm | |
| Nov | 9° | 4° | 77 mm | |
| Dec | 6° | 2° | 81 mm |
